Overview

LF253DT from STMicroelectronics is a wide-bandwidth dual JFET-input operational amplifier in SO-8 package, rated for -40°C to +105°C operation. It delivers 16 V/µs typical slew rate, ±11 V input common-mode range (up to VCC+), 1012 Ω input resistance, and 2.5–4 MHz gain-bandwidth product-enabling precision signal conditioning in industrial sensor interfaces and high-fidelity audio preamplifiers.

Technical Context

The LF253DT integrates matched high-voltage JFET and bipolar transistors on a monolithic die, enabling high slew rate (12–16 V/µs) and low input offset voltage drift (10 µV/°C). Its JFET input stage provides ultra-high input impedance and low input bias current that doubles every 10°C rise in junction temperature.

It features internal frequency compensation for unity-gain stability, latch-up free operation, and rail-to-rail input common-mode range extending beyond supply rails (±11 V at ±15 V supply). Output short-circuit protection allows indefinite grounding without damage under thermal limits.

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
Slew Rate 12–16 V/µs typical - enables fast settling for pulse amplification and active filter stages
Gain-Bandwidth Product 2.5–4 MHz - supports stable closed-loop gain up to ~100 at 40 kHz
Input Bias Current 20–200 pA at 25°C - minimizes DC error in high-impedance sensor front-ends
Input Offset Voltage 3–13 mV - requires external nulling for sub-mV precision applications
Common-Mode Range ±11 V (at ±15 V supply) - accepts inputs beyond rails, simplifying level-shifting circuits
Supply Voltage Range ±5 V to ±18 V - supports both low-power and high-dynamic-range analog systems
Output Short-Circuit Duration Infinite - permits robust fault tolerance without external current limiting

Pinout & Package

LF253DT uses an SO-8 plastic micro package (ECOPACK® compliant), 4.8–5.0 mm × 5.8–6.2 mm body, 1.27 mm lead pitch, with gull-wing leads and 1.75 mm max height.

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
1 Output 1 Amplifier A output; capable of ±12 V swing into 2 kΩ load
2 Inverting Input 1 High-impedance node for feedback network connection
3 Non-inverting Input 1 High-Z input accepting signals up to ±11 V relative to ground
4 VCC Negative supply rail; reference for internal biasing and output swing
5 Non-inverting Input 2 Independent high-Z input for second amplifier channel
6 Inverting Input 2 Second amplifier's feedback node; electrically isolated from Channel 1
7 Output 2 Amplifier B output; identical performance and drive capability as Pin 1
8 VCC+ Positive supply rail; completes dual-supply operation and bias path

Key Features

Feature Design Value
High Input Impedance 1012 Ω - preserves signal integrity in piezoelectric sensor and photodiode interfaces
Low Input Offset Drift 10 µV/°C - reduces thermal-induced DC error in uncalibrated industrial measurement systems
Internal Frequency Compensation Unity-gain stable - eliminates need for external compensation capacitors in standard configurations
Output Short-Circuit Protection Infinite duration - enables safe use in test equipment and motor driver feedback loops
Latch-Up Free Operation Guaranteed per JEDEC JESD78 - ensures reliability during power sequencing and overvoltage transients

FAQ

Is LF253DT pin-compatible with LF353DT?

Yes-LF253DT and LF353DT share identical SO-8 pinout, electrical characteristics, and functional behavior. The sole difference is operating temperature range: LF253DT is rated for -40°C to +105°C, while LF353DT is limited to 0°C to +70°C. No PCB or schematic changes are needed for substitution where temperature requirements allow.
